What information we collect

We collect three categories of information about you: information you provide, information we collect automatically, and information we obtain from other sources.

We do not collect information about your racial or ethnic origin, political opinions or membership of any political association, religious or philosophical beliefs, trade-union membership, genetic data, or data concerning a person’s sex life or sexual orientation.

Information you provide

Registration and Courier information may include first name, surname, middle name, date of birth, residential address, contact phone number, e-mail, photo and video image, and identity document.

User generated content that you choose to upload while using our Services, such as comments, ratings, and reviews.

Information in correspondence you send to us may include chat messages, emails with any attachments, recordings of phone calls you make to us and the related metadata.

Information for promotions. From time to time, we may run promotional programs. If you wish to participate in such programs and receive bonuses, payments or other benefits, we may ask you to provide information such as your name, email, user ID, phone number, payment or banking information, address, social media account and image.

Information we collect automatically

Location information. We collect your location data for orders’ routing and assignment, to ensure the proper operation of our App, for security and anti-fraud purposes, and to comply with legal requirements.

Transaction information. We collect transaction information related to the Services, including the type of Services requested or provided, order details, amount charged, payment method, payment transaction information, and date and time the service was provided.

Usage information. We collect data about your use of our App, such as access dates and times, features or pages viewed, App crashes and other system activity. We may also collect and use for marketing purposes the data related to third-party services you used before interacting with the App.

Communications information. We enable users to communicate with each other and with us through the App. To facilitate this, we receive data about the time and date of the communications and the content. We may also use this data to provide support to other users or our clients, for security purposes, to resolve disputes between users, to improve our Services, and for analytical purposes (for example, to evaluate and improve the effectiveness of the Site).

Device information. We collect information about the device you use to access the App, such as your device name, brand and model, user agent, IP address, mobile carrier, network type, time zone settings, language settings, advertising identifiers, browser type, operating system and its version, screen parameters, battery state, and installed applications that can be used for authentication and anti-fraud purposes. We may also collect mobile sensor data, such as speed, direction, altitude, acceleration, deceleration, and other technical data.

Cookies and tracking technologies. We collect information through the use of cookies, pixels, tags and other similar tracking technologies ("cookies").

Information we obtain from other sources

Subcontractors and Partners. We may receive data about users from our subcontractors, partners and other InDrive products and services.

State authorities. We may receive information about users from law enforcement agencies and other government authorities as required or authorized by law.

Other users or third parties. Other Users and third parties may provide us with information about you, including through customer service or in connection with claims or disputes. We retain and use such information only if we could lawfully obtain it from you. We will take appropriate action as is reasonable under the circumstances to inform you of the receipt of such information.

How we store your information

We keep your personal information for as long as necessary to provide the Services and for the other purposes set forth in this policy.

Retention periods vary depending on the type of data and the purposes for which we use the data.

When we process your data to provide the Service, we keep the data until your account is deleted. We may keep user data after your account is deleted in accordance with legal or other regulatory requirements or for the reasons set forth in this policy. If you violate the License Agreement or InDrive.Delivery or InDrive global policies, we will have a right to keep your data for as long as we may need to investigate the violation. We also keep data for the purpose of responding to any claims regarding the Services.
